Tasmania Fire Service received the call out to the residential property on Weld Street at about 1.11pm on Sunday, a TFS spokesperson said.
The fire is now contained, with crews ventilating smoke before they begin investigations into how and where the blaze began.

Nobody is believed to have been home at the time of the blaze, the spokesperson said.
Three units from Beaconsfield were assisted by two others from Gravelly Beach and another from Kelso.
